2. AI Features and Third-Party AI Data Sharing
NutriCise AI includes AI-powered features that may help users with nutrition analysis, food ratings, meal suggestions, macro targets, exercise recommendations, daily summaries, and AI coaching.
When you choose to use an AI feature, NutriCise AI may send certain information to a third-party AI service in order to generate a response.
Third-Party AI Service Used
NutriCise AI uses OpenAI to provide AI-generated responses. User requests are routed through our secure Supabase Edge Function backend before being sent to OpenAI. OpenAI states that API data is not used to train its models by default for business/API customers unless the customer opts in.
Data That May Be Sent to OpenAI
Depending on the AI feature you choose to use, the following data may be sent to OpenAI through our Supabase backend:
Your written goal or fitness/nutrition objective
Food names, calories, protein, carbs, and fat values
Exercise names, duration, intensity, and calories burned
Meal descriptions
Food or nutrition label text recognized from images
Images or image-derived data when you choose to analyze a meal photo
Health-related context you choose to use for personalization, such as workout activity, sleep, or energy information
Your question or chat message to the AI coach
Relevant app context needed to generate a useful response
NutriCise AI does not intentionally send unnecessary personal identifiers to OpenAI. However, if you type personal information into an AI prompt, upload an image containing personal information, or include personal details in your goals, that information may be included in the AI request.
User Permission Before AI Sharing
Before NutriCise AI sends personal data to a third-party AI service, the app will explain:
What data may be sent
That the data may be sent to OpenAI
That the data is sent through Supabase Edge Functions
That the AI response is generated by a third-party AI provider
That the user can decline and avoid using AI features
AI features are optional. If you do not consent to AI data sharing, you should not use AI-powered features that require sending data to OpenAI.
Apple’s App Review Guidelines require apps to clearly disclose third-party AI data sharing and obtain permission before sharing personal data with third-party AI services.

4. Third-Party Services We Use
NutriCise AI may use third-party services to operate the app.
Supabase
We use Supabase for backend infrastructure, authentication, database storage, and Edge Functions. Supabase may process account data, saved app data, goals, food logs, exercise logs, and AI request routing. Supabase explains that its services involve the collection, use, and disclosure of personal information in connection with its platform.
Supabase Edge Functions are used to securely call OpenAI without placing the OpenAI API key inside the app.
OpenAI
We use OpenAI to generate AI-powered responses for nutrition, food, workout, and coaching features. Data is sent to OpenAI only when needed to provide AI functionality and after user permission is requested in the app.
OpenAI states that API data is not used to train its models by default for business/API users unless the organization explicitly opts in.
Firebase
NutriCise AI may use Firebase services, including Firebase Authentication and Firestore, for account authentication, cloud data storage, and syncing. Firebase provides privacy and security information for developers using its services.
Apple HealthKit
If you grant permission, NutriCise AI may read selected Apple Health data. HealthKit permissions are controlled by Apple’s system permission prompts and can be changed at any time in iOS Settings or the Health app.
StoreKit and App Store Purchases
NutriCise AI uses Apple StoreKit to process subscriptions, purchases, free trials, offer codes, and subscription entitlements. Payment information is handled by Apple, not directly by NutriCise AI.
Google Mobile Ads
If ads are enabled in the app, Google Mobile Ads may collect or process advertising-related data according to Google’s policies and your device settings. Ads may be personalized or non-personalized depending on your choices, device settings, and applicable law.
Open Food Facts
If you search for foods or scan barcodes, NutriCise AI may retrieve product and nutrition information from Open Food Facts or a similar public food database.
